Styles

The appeal of French Doors is in their ability to combine outdoor and indoor spaces. No matter if you want to put them in your home's interior or exterior, these doors feature multiple panes of glass that flood living spaces with natural light while establishing visual continuity between rooms. However, the type of French door you choose will affect the cost and performance.

Doors are offered at a lower cost, but they may not be as durable or provide inadequate insulation. More expensive options are made of sturdy materials that can stand up to the elements in the Mid-Atlantic and require less maintenance.

For instance wood French doors are a fantastic option for those who prefer traditional style and have enough space to accommodate them. However, they require regular care and attention to maintain their appearance and functionality. Similarly, vinyl French doors are simpler to maintain in good condition than wooden doors, however they're more susceptible to warping and provide a lower level of insulation.

The way outswing and inswing French door open is different. The former opens onto your home, while the latter opens onto the patio. They can be made from one door or many that are connected and come in a variety of sizes. They can also be embellished with a variety of accessories that match their appearance and improve security or privacy, like window grilles.

Materials

French doors can add a touch of elegance to your home. They can be one or two hinged door that opens to let in light and fresh air. French door options also include decorative glass and other details like transoms and sidelites. They are available as sliding or inswing doors that can be constructed using a variety of materials. The material you select will determine how your French doors function and also their longevity.

Vinyl, fiberglass and wood are all popular French door materials. Each has its advantages and drawbacks, so it's important to think about what your French doors are used and the climate in which you live when choosing a material. Exterior French doors, for example should be constructed of hardwoods like mahogany, cedar, and oak which are more durable and resist moisture better than softwoods such as fir and alder. The glass you select can also affect the quality. Triple-paned or double-paned glass is more efficient in terms of energy efficiency and insulation than single-pane glass. You can choose low-e coated glass to keep the sun's heat out in summer and its warmth inside during winter.

As with all types of door, French doors require regular maintenance to maintain their appearance. Over time, hinges will need to checked and adjusted. The wood frames should be examined for signs of warping and rot. Because of the precision required to put the glass panes and frame the repairs are usually best left to professionals.

Like all doors, upvc french door handle replacement doors must also be regularly cleaned to prevent buildup of grime and dirt which could stain the glass and detract from your home's overall appearance. A common household cleaning solution is made up of equal parts water and white vinegar, which can be applied using a soft cloth to the windows and glass. If you choose to make use of a commercial cleaner, be sure that it is specifically designed for the type and size of glass on your doors.

You can also avoid the need for expensive repairs by keeping up with the routine maintenance of your door's hardware, locks and handles. This could involve lubricating moving parts for smooth operation, replacing or repairing locks periodically and keeping track of the condition of your door seals.

It is recommended to replace damaged weather strips to preserve the insulation properties of your doors. This is a fairly inexpensive procedure and can help you save energy by preventing air leaks and lowering the cost of cooling and heating.
